Study the core of mechatronics and robotics - from intelligent system design to control and embedded systems. Turn concepts into creations using 3D CAD, 3D printing, laser cutting and the iForge makerspace.

Bring robots and intelligent machines to life with a degree that combines mechanics, electronics, computing and control.

Informed by world-leading research and designed with industry partners, this course equips you with the skills, creativity and hands-on experience to become a highly employable engineer. You’ll work with industry standard equipment and explore real applications in robotics, industrial control and advanced manufacturing.

In Year 1, you will build a solid foundation in mathematics, computing, electronics and system modelling, while gaining teamwork and project skills.

Year 2 expands into robot principles, mechanics and machine vision alongside control, communications and embedded systems. Apply your knowledge in practical design projects, learning programming and system integration.

In Year 3, you will undertake an advanced project and specialise in one of two specialisations that matches your ambitions:

  • Mechatronics & Robotics – eg robot design, motion planning, sensor fusion, machine learning.
  • Control – eg digital signal processing, control systems design, machine learning and optimisation.

Graduates of this course are highly sought after in sectors such as robotics, aerospace, automotive, energy and advanced manufacturing.

Accreditation

This course is accredited by the Institution of Engineering and Technology (IET), the Institute of Measurement and Control and the Engineering Council UK.
